Find a few forums related to your blog and take part in the discussions. It won’t be difficult since you are familiar with the subject.
Here is an excellent site listing many different forums.
It is also easy to find any forum through Google. Just type in “keywords+forum” in the search bar. Below are three examples:
Dog Lovers Forums, Golf Forums, Real Estate Forums,
Try to leave only worthwhile comments with a link pointing to your blog.
Having both a blog and a forum, allows you to manipulate your traffic easily. For example, an announcement on your forum will cause most of the forum’s visitors to return to your blog. In doing so, you will generate a constant stream of “recycled traffic.”
